  • Thank you for your enquiry. I have visited site and assessed the trees in their location. The trees present are on land not deemed to be part of the publicly maintained highway by OCC in our capacity as local highway authority. The trees present are on land maintainable by an adjacent landowner and not by the County Council. You can access the land registry at: https://www.gov.uk/ search-property-information-land-registry to find details of the adjacent landowner to pursue your enquiry. You are also within your common law rights as a landowner to cut any overhanging vegetation back to the boundary line of your property.
